INSTANTrip bets AI replaces trip planning; App Store travel #1 in 3 weeks
A Konkuk student's AI travel curator hit App Store travel #1 in 3 weeks; by 2026 Grunui is pitching B2B travel-data analytics
Grunui (그루누이) · INSTANTrip (인스턴트립)
What the business is
INSTANTrip is an AI travel curation app: users enter a budget and dates, and AI recommends and books flights, hotels, eSIM and activities, positioned with the slogan 'travel without worries'.
Starting capital:No venture round disclosed; selected for Konkuk University's 2025 'pre-startup package' (예비창업패키지), providing commercialization funds and mentoring.
How it started
Ahn Young-bin, an electrical engineering student at Konkuk University (class of 2019), founded Grunui through the KU Startup Club. In January 2025 he visited CES through Konkuk's global startup frontier program; the team built INSTANTrip around the pain of juggling flights, hotels, eSIM and activities across multiple booking sites.
What happened
INSTANTrip officially launched on 2025-04-21. Within three weeks it reached #1 in the Apple App Store travel category and #32 in the overall popularity chart, prompting coverage across Korean media; the company announced partnerships with Trip.com, HotelsCombined and Agoda, and was selected for Konkuk's 2025 pre-startup package with commercialization funds and mentoring for global expansion.
How it ended up
Still live and expanding: by January 2026 Grunui was pitching a new AI-based travel-data analytics solution (CatchProg) on Venturesquare, signaling a B2B pivot beyond the consumer app; no funding round or revenue figures have been disclosed.

What has to be true
- The wedge was simplicity: budget and dates in, a full itinerary with bookings out — a clear contrast to juggling multiple OTA sites.
- App Store chart mechanics rewarded the launch: a new, free, AI-flagged travel app surged to category #1 within three weeks, generating press.
- University programs supplied what a student founder lacked: CES exposure, commercialization funds and mentoring.
- The pivot to travel-data analytics (CatchProg) suggests consumer travel apps monetize poorly — a hedge into B2B data.
What can be applied
A chart win can validate a consumer bet, but without disclosed revenue the moat is unproven — Grunui's 2026 shift toward travel-data analytics shows how a student startup hedges a crowded category.
